CELINA IS A GIGABIT CITY WITH TWO A-RATED SCHOOL DISTRICTS

The Texas Education Agency provides annual academic accountability ratings to public school districts, charters, and schools. These ratings, which range from A to F, are based on performance on state standardized tests, graduation rates, and post-education readiness outcomes.

​

For multiple years in a row, the two school districts servicing Celina students - the Celina and Prosper Independent School Districts - have received A ratings.

The mission of Celina Public Library is to facilitate the increase of knowledge within the community by providing exemplary personnel, facilities, materials and services that nurture imagination, exploration, discovery and learning, changing lives through the transforming power of information and ideas. The Library seeks to encourage imagination, exploration, discovery, and learning through all of the programs and services they provide to the community.

 

Individuals must register for a Celina Public Library card to check out materials. Any Texas resident may apply for a Celina Public Library card by filling out an application and providing a government-issued picture ID. For those under 18, a parent or legal guardian must complete the form in person. 

1st Gigabit City in the State of Texas

SquareSpeedImage_reduced.png

In 2020, Celina received official designation as a Gigabit City from the Office of the Governor Greg Abbott. This means that every residence and business within the city has access to a minimum of 1 Gbps (Gigabit per second) up and down connectivity speed. Thanks to fiber optic lines, our open access network will have faster communication and internet speeds for consumers and commercial businesses alike. This fundamental aspect of infrastructure will help to educate youth, create jobs, promote public safety, improve citizens’ standards of living and deliver essential services. 

Collin College - Celina Campus

Set on approximately 75 acres, the Celina campus provides greater access to higher education for northwestern Collin County.  The campus facilities include classrooms, computer labs, science labs, and a workforce lab. To support students, the campus amenities also feature a library, tutoring center, career center, testing center, bookstore, and more!

​

Starting in Fall 2021, the Celina Campus offers programs in Business Management, Construction Management, Health Science, and Information Technology. For more information visit collin.edu/campuses/celina.
